xref: /netbsd-src/external/gpl3/gcc/lib/Makefile.hacks (revision e89934bbf778a6d6d6894877c4da59d0c7835b0f)
1#	$NetBSD: Makefile.hacks,v 1.5 2016/03/17 08:02:38 mrg Exp $
2
3# some random crap we need in a few places
4
5.if ${MACHINE_CPU} == "mips"
6insn-constants.h:
7	${_MKTARGET_CREATE}
8	echo "enum processor { on, off };" > ${.TARGET}
9DPSRCS+=	insn-constants.h
10CLEANFILES+=	insn-constants.h
11.else
12FAKEHEADERS+=	insn-constants.h
13.endif
14
15# these aren't necessary but are #include'd
16FAKEHEADERS+=	${EXTRA_FAKEHEADERS} insn-flags.h sysroot-suffix.h
17${FAKEHEADERS}:
18	${_MKTARGET_CREATE}
19	touch ${.TARGET}
20DPSRCS+=	${FAKEHEADERS}
21CLEANFILES+=	${FAKEHEADERS}
22